Taiyuan vs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Taiyuan, China and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i, Usa is approximately 10,914 km or 6,782 mi.
  • To reach Taiyuan in this distance one would set out from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i bearing 347.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Taiyuan bearing 191.4° or SSW .
  • Taiyuan has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Taiyuan is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 0.8 °C (1.4°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.6 °C (4.7°F) more in Taiyuan.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 339.6 mm (13.4 in) less which is equivalent to 339.6 l/m² (8.33 US gal/ft²) or 3,396,000 l/ha (363,055 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.4° higher in Taiyuan than in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i.
